For the Zakharov system in four space dimensions, we prove that all solutions inside the potential well of the ground states are global and scattering in the energy space, with no other restriction such as symmetry. The proof has already been reduced by [3] to ruling out the existence of a minimal non-scattering solution that is precompact along some trajectory. This paper carries out the final step in the proof, namely we exclude the possibility of precompact solutions inside the potential well by combining two distinct arguments depending on the motion of trajectory.
